Consequences of polar icecap melting under an anti-sun scenario

Determine the environmental and Earth-system consequences that follow from polar icecaps melting into the ocean due to increased gamma-ray energy deposition at high latitudes produced by annihilation of antimatter solar wind in the anti-sun scenario.

Background

In the proposed anti-sun scenario, half a kilogram per second of antimatter solar wind would annihilate with Earth's atmosphere, generating intense gamma radiation concentrated near the poles. The authors argue this added energy would disrupt thermal equilibrium and melt the polar icecaps into the ocean, but explicitly state they do not know the subsequent outcomes, highlighting an unresolved question about downstream ecological and climatic effects.
